Latest Patents

Among his latest innovations are patents related to implantable medical devices. These patents include details about a range of medical devices designed to improve functionality and patient outcomes. One notable patent elaborates on an implantable pacing member composed of a housing and a lead input, where the lead is engineered to extend along the pericardial space and engage with heart chambers. Another recent patent discusses an implant tool and an improved electrode design aimed at minimally invasive procedures. This implantable baroreflex activation system features a control system within an implantable housing, paired with an electrical lead and an electrode structure. This configuration is designed for effective implantation on blood vessels, delivering baroreflex therapy via a monopolar electrode.
